jQuery流程图是一种用于表示JavaScript库jQuery中代码执行顺序和逻辑关系的图形化表示方法,通过绘制流程图,可以更直观地理解代码的执行过程,便于代码的编写和维护,本文将详细介绍如何使用jQuery流程图来表示和分析代码。
1、jQuery流程图的基本元素
在jQuery流程图中,有以下几个基本元素:
- 矩形:表示一个过程或操作,如函数调用、条件判断等。
- 菱形:表示一个判断条件,如if语句。
- 圆形:表示开始或结束。
- 平行四边形:表示输入或输出。
- 连接线:表示各个元素之间的逻辑关系。
2、jQuery流程图的绘制方法
要绘制一个jQuery流程图,可以使用一些专业的绘图工具,如Visio、draw.io等,以下是使用draw.io绘制jQuery流程图的步骤:
- 打开draw.io网站,点击“新建”按钮,选择“流程图”。
- 在画布上添加矩形、菱形、圆形等基本元素,并使用连接线连接它们。
- 为每个元素添加描述性文本,以便于理解代码的逻辑关系。
- 根据需要调整元素的布局和样式。
- 保存并分享流程图。
3、jQuery流程图的示例
下面是一个简单的jQuery流程图示例,用于表示一个简单的点击事件处理函数:
graph TD; A[开始] --> B(获取点击元素); B --> C{判断是否为按钮}; C -- 是 --> D(执行按钮点击事件); C -- 否 --> E(忽略点击); D --> F[结束]; E --> F;
在这个示例中,我们首先创建了一个开始节点A和一个结束节点F,我们添加了一个矩形B,表示获取点击元素的过程,接下来,我们添加了一个菱形C,表示判断点击元素是否为按钮的条件,如果点击元素是按钮,我们执行按钮点击事件(矩形D),否则忽略点击(矩形E),我们将D和E连接到结束节点F。
4、jQuery流程图的优势
使用jQuery流程图有以下优势:
- 提高代码可读性:通过绘制流程图,可以更直观地展示代码的执行顺序和逻辑关系,便于阅读和理解。
- 便于代码维护:当代码发生修改时,可以通过更新流程图来快速了解代码的变化情况,有助于减少错误和遗漏。
- 促进团队协作:通过共享流程图,团队成员可以更好地理解彼此的工作,提高协作效率。
- 便于教学和培训:对于初学者来说,通过流程图可以更快地掌握代码的结构和逻辑,有助于提高学习效果。
5、jQuery流程图的应用场景
jQuery流程图可以应用于以下场景:
- 编写和优化jQuery代码:在编写和优化jQuery代码时,可以使用流程图来分析和理解代码的执行过程,有助于提高代码质量和性能。
- 代码审查和测试:在代码审查和测试过程中,可以使用流程图来检查代码的逻辑是否正确,以及是否存在潜在的问题。
- 技术文档和教程:在编写技术文档和教程时,可以使用流程图来展示代码的结构和逻辑,帮助读者更好地理解和学习。
- 培训和演示:在进行培训和演示时,可以使用流程图来展示代码的执行过程,提高讲解的效果和观众的理解程度。
jQuery流程图是一种非常实用的工具,可以帮助我们更好地理解和分析jQuery代码,通过学习和掌握jQuery流程图的绘制方法和应用技巧,我们可以更高效地编写和维护jQuery代码,提高开发效率和质量。